1. Platform Disparity
The core issue surrounding the availability of this specific application centers on platform disparity, specifically the absence of an official version for the Android operating system. This disparity is primarily attributed to the application’s origins as an exclusive offering within the iOS ecosystem, closely integrated with Apple’s iMessage platform. The development focus remained solely on the iOS environment, leaving the Android user base without direct access to the identical application.
This platform exclusivity creates a fragmented user experience, where iOS users can readily engage in multiplayer games via iMessage, while Android users lack a corresponding, directly equivalent solution. 7. Development Challenges
The creation of a gaming application with functionality similar to the iOS-based application, particularly for Android, presents a multitude of development challenges. These challenges stem from the need to replicate a user experience tightly integrated with a specific ecosystem while operating within the constraints of a different platform. A primary obstacle lies in achieving seamless integration with Android’s diverse messaging applications. Unlike iOS, which offers a unified messaging platform (iMessage), Android applications must contend with a fragmented landscape of messaging apps, each with its own APIs and functionalities. This fragmentation necessitates extensive adaptation and testing to ensure compatibility across various messaging clients.
Another significant hurdle involves the replication of real-time multiplayer functionality. Ensuring smooth and synchronized gameplay across a wide range of Android devices, each with varying hardware specifications and network conditions, requires sophisticated network programming and robust server infrastructure. Latency issues, synchronization errors, and device compatibility problems can severely impact the user experience. Question 1: Is a direct version of the application available for Android devices?
No, a direct, official port of the application does not exist for the Android operating system. The application was originally developed and remains exclusive to the iOS platform, specifically integrated within iMessage.
Question 2: Do alternative applications on Android provide identical functionality?
Android alternatives attempt to mimic certain aspects of the application, such as mini-game collections and multiplayer interaction. However, these alternatives often differ in user experience, feature sets, and the degree of integration with messaging platforms.
Question 3: What are the primary limitations of Android alternatives?
Limitations may include incomplete game selection, fragmented messaging integration (requiring users to switch between apps), and varying degrees of real-time multiplayer synchronization quality. Additionally, accessibility options might not be as robust compared to the iOS version or the Android system’s native accessibility features.
Question 4: Are there cross-platform games that offer a similar experience?
Yes, several cross-platform multiplayer games are available on both iOS and Android. These games allow users on different operating systems to play together, albeit requiring separate application downloads and installations, rather than the direct integration within messaging.
Question 5: Why has an official Android version not been developed?
Development decisions regarding platform exclusivity are often driven by factors such as strategic focus, resource allocation, and integration with proprietary platform features. In this instance, the application’s tight integration with iMessage likely contributed to the decision to remain exclusive to iOS.
